The Oracle Advanced DBA Training aims to provide participants with in-depth knowledge and hands-on skills essential for managing and administering Oracle DBA, RAC, Dataguard and (Advanced DBA) environments efficiently.  

By the end of the course, participants will be able to: 

Oracle Database Architecture: Understand the core architecture, including memory structures, background processes, logical and physical storage, and multitenant environments. 

Database Creation & Management: Learn to create and manage standard databases, CDBs, and PDBs, including cloning, unplugging, and plugging PDBs. 

Database Connectivity & Security: Gain expertise in database connectivity, user account management, granting roles and privileges, and configuring authentication mechanisms. 

Tablespace & Storage Management: Master creating, altering, and encrypting tablespaces, managing storage space, and reclaiming unused space. 

Oracle Net Services & Network Configuration: Configure and manage Oracle Net Services, listeners, database links, and troubleshoot connectivity using tools like tnsping. 

Backup & Recovery Using RMAN: Learn RMAN backup concepts, incremental backups, retention policies, and perform complete/incomplete database recovery scenarios. 

High Availability with Data Guard: Configure and manage Data Guard for high availability, perform switchover/failover using DGMGRL, and maintain snapshot standby databases. 

Oracle RAC & Clusterware Administration: Deploy and manage Oracle RAC clusters, administer ASM instances, manage backup and recovery for RAC, and configure load balancing. 

Exadata Database Machine: Understand Exadata architecture, hardware configurations, smart scan, smart flash cache, and migrate databases to Exadata. 

Patching, Upgrading & Database Cloning: Perform database patching, upgrade from Oracle 12.2 to 19c, manage rolling upgrades, and duplicate databases using RMAN.
